Random orbital motion with a 125mm pad produces even, swirl-free sanding. Low weight and an ergonomic grip reduce fatigue during extended use.
Precise Control – With 6 variable speeds
A 300W copper motor drives speeds from 4,000 to 12,000 OPM, letting the user match aggressiveness to the task. Lower speeds suit flat finishing while higher speeds remove paint or smooth rough timber faster.
Adjustable speed gives control over material removal and final texture. That control reduces the risk of over-sanding and helps achieve a consistent finish.
Cleaner Workspace – With an efficient dust collection system
A 0.3L dust bag attaches to a rubber-sealed dust port and sealed cartridge to improve airflow and capture shavings and fine particles. The hook-up keeps airborne dust lower than with open sanding.
Collected dust makes it easier to see progress and cuts down cleanup time. Safer breathing conditions result when sanding for extended periods.
Comfort for Long Jobs – Thanks to low vibration and ergonomic grip
The random orbital mechanism and soft-grip rubber handle reduce transmitted vibration, and a lightweight 1.3 kg body helps with single-handed operation. The pad and sealing also contribute to steadier handling.
Reduced vibration and a comfortable grip minimise hand fatigue during lengthy sessions. Steadier handling helps produce more uniform results across larger surfaces.

📋 Technical Details at a Glance
- Power: 300W copper motor
- Speed Range: 4,000–12,000 OPM
- Sanding Pad Size: 125 mm
- Pad Attachment: Hook and loop
- Dust Collection: 0.3L dust bag with rubber-sealed dust port and sealed cartridge
